Fulham - Just One of Those Things Mate!

It was one of those incidents that ninety-nine times out of a hundred would have ended differently.

When in the eightieth minute Paul Konchesky ran onto that looping ball, you were just urging to see him direct it back to the keeper, Mark Schwarzer, or simply stick it out for a throw-in.

Instead, he got caught in no-mans land and the rest is history.

As Roy Hodgson mentioned in his post match interview, Konchesky would have been the last one you thought would make such a mistake considering the performances he has put in previously for our club.

Here at Vital Fulham we`d urge Paul to simply put it to the back of his mind and consider it a one off. To dwell on it would only make things worse, these things happen, we`ll live with it!
